Asphalt Vs. Concrete! What You Should Know

These 2 materials are the most common options for a driveway project. Asphalt is perfect for roadways because you’re ready to use it as soon as you get to lay it down, which is why it’s used so often on interstates. As far as concrete goes, it’s a more stable and durable surface. However, it needs time to set and cure before you can use it. Here is a list of their pros & cons:

Concrete Pros & Cons

Enhanced Curb Appeal For Your Home

As concrete is available in various colors and patterns, it can significantly enhance your home’s curb appeal. You can also go for a stamped concrete driveway which gives it a more textured look.

Low Maintenance & Long-Lasting

Once your concrete driveway is installed, you don’t have to worry about maintaining it regularly. A little power washing from time to time will suffice. Moreover, it has a lifespan of 30 years or more if properly taken care of.

Weeds Won’t Grow Through Concrete

You won’t have to worry about weeds growing through your concrete driveway as they cannot penetrate its dense surface. As a result, you won’t have to spend time and money on weed control.

Asphalt Pros & Cons

Asphalt Is Less Expensive Than Concrete

The initial cost of asphalt is cheaper than concrete. Also, repairs and maintenance costs are lower for asphalt driveways. But these are usually more frequent.

Asphalt Driveways Are Ready To Use

You can usually drive on an asphalt driveway the day after it’s installed. Helping you save time to complete your project.

Asphalt requires More upkeep And Spread

Asphalt driveways require more upkeep, such as seal coating every few years. Also, they’re susceptible to fractures and spread quickly. Asphalt creates uneven edges making it prone to weeds.
